Event Description
"literature article entitled, ¿efficacy of tranexamic acid on blood loss after primary cementless total hip replacement with rivaroxaban thromboprophylaxis: a case-control study in 70 patients¿ by a.Clave, et al, published by orthopaedics and traumatology: surgery and research (2012), vol.98, pp.484-490, was reviewed.The objective of study was to assess the efficacy of tranexamic acid in reducing blood loss during primary cementless thr with associated rivaroxaban thromboprophylaxis.Implanted depuy products: gyros dual mobility cup, polyethylene liner, femoral head, and corail stem.Results: 1 patient had postoperative transfusions of a total of 10 units of whole blood and 1 unit of prbc over 6 days due to hemoglobinemia- coded major bleed.1 postoperative hematoma- treatment unspecified.1 intraoperative acetabular fracture treated with allograft and fixation plates and cementation of the cup.1 intraoperative fracture of the femur treated with cerclage.Captured in this complaint: gyros cup, liner, and head: no reported product problem.Corail stem: no reported product problem.Patient harms: major bleed, hematoma, fracture.".
